The Little Giant King Kombo is a professional-grade, award-winning 3-in-1 fiberglass ladder offering 7 ft extension and 4 ft A-frame configurations. Engineered for safety and versatility, it features a rotating wall pad for corner access, a narrow rear section for tight spaces, and a Type 1AA 375 lbs weight rating. Its non-conductive Hi-Viz green fiberglass design makes it ideal for electricians and pros working around electricity, meeting or exceeding all OSHA and ANSI standards.

Just what I had hoped for...
re: Little Giant King Kombo 8ft I hunted and never found the ACTUAL dimensions (even on the manufacturer's web site ... shame on you folks!). Once unpacked I took a tape measure to it... In its "standard" V configuration the overall (vertical) height is: 7'6". So it WILL work/fit in an 8ft ceiling room. Fully extended (extension ladder style) it is 13'. It's quite light (like any well made, fiberglass ladder you might imagine) and very well built. It arrived in one large, rather abused box. Once unpacked the ladder was fine / no worse for wear. As described by the manufacturer, the pitch lever makes it trivial to use. That said, the lever is located near the top of the ladder (at the hinge point). So, vertically challenged people may find that part of the equation a bit difficult. YMMV. It is "HELLO! I'M GREEN!" Green in color.

I love this ladder, and I don't like ladders :)
I hate ladders, generally speaking. I'm a bigger guy and traditional telescoping aluminum ladders make me very uncomfortable. This ladder has drasticly changed my perspective and comfort level around them. No matter if it's in the "A" position or in the extended position, it feels so solidly planted and doesn't bow out as I'm navigating it. I would say that this ladder is probably one best kept in a garage or something, at least in this size. It's a bit too big for being an indoor, step ladder for shelf access, etc. This is my new "go to" for outdoor use. I used it to put up christmas decorations and install security cameras.

Not put togather correctly or checked
This is my second LG ladder. This is a great ladder but LG quality control did not check to see if it worked! The square steel bar that locks the positions was out of the channel and the ladder could not be opened. This bar cannot be knocked out of alignment accidentally and was assembled incorrectly and no one checked to see if it worked. I offered to send a photo but as soon as phone help realized I got it from Amazon, they recommended sending it back! Finally I was able to align the bar to the opening on other side and tap it into place with a hammer. Past LG ladders have been champions of quality. Quality control and help is a big disappointment! Edit May 2022 Other than the poor quality control and customer support noted above, after a year of use this is the best utility ladder I've ever used. Will get one for my son.
